Corrections Week Celebrated With Enthusiasm at Shakopee

By Joshua Fargusson

Here in Shakopee, Corrections Week was celebrated with different meals/desserts/snacks each day of the work week. Everything from bagels, to tacos, to the overwhelmingly popular ice cream day. As you can see, some were perhaps a little too excited for ice cream day! (We were unfortunately not fast enough with the camera to capture the reverse 1/2 somersault with 4 1/2 twists performed prior to this 10 point ice cream celebrated landing.)

We chalked it up to the emergence of spring and the overabundance of energetic enthusiasm it inspires. Hope everyone had a wonderful Corrections Week!!!
